Reassembling the cross slide servo motor

Time to reassemble all the cross slide gubbins.

Let's make this limit switch wiring a bit more practical. Currently I have to unsolder the wires to get the cable through the hole in the ballscrew mount.





I'll machine it back like this. But I'll do it manually on The Shiz, as I have better things to do than bugger about creating toolpaths in Fusion.


Do it


There you go.


Sorted. Limit switches refitted and reconnected. And encoder read head in position. Rapid epoxy used to route and anchor the cables.


Can I remove the inline connector for the encoder? If I could directly terminate the cable within the motor housing, the wiring would be much simpler. Short answer - no. The encoder doesn't look very accessible without major surgery. The last thing I want is to have to realign the encoder to the rotor, which may be tricky as I don't have access to the factory tools.


Right, that's it back together again. The back is a lot simpler now, without the ballscrew and encoder.


Now let's go round to the front and see about fitting the encoder etc....
